.skill-tag[data-v-77ab7c0c]{display:inline-block;padding:5px 12px;margin:4px;border-radius:99px;font-size:.8rem;font-weight:500;background:rgba(61,139,232,.08);color:var(--accent);border:1px solid rgba(61,139,232,.2);letter-spacing:.02em;transition:background .2s ease,border-color .2s ease}.skill-tag[data-v-77ab7c0c]:hover{background:rgba(61,139,232,.15);border-color:rgba(61,139,232,.4)}.resume[data-v-51160948]{padding-bottom:80px}.resume-layout[data-v-51160948]{display:grid;grid-template-columns:1fr;gap:48px;padding-bottom:40px}.resume-section-title[data-v-51160948]{font-size:1rem;font-weight:600;color:var(--text-muted);text-transform:uppercase;letter-spacing:.08em;margin-bottom:28px;padding-bottom:12px;border-bottom:1px solid var(--border);display:flex;align-items:center;gap:10px}.resume-section-title i[data-v-51160948]{color:var(--accent)}.resume-section[data-v-51160948]{margin-bottom:48px}.timeline-item[data-v-51160948]{display:grid;grid-template-columns:16px 1fr;gap:0 20px;margin-bottom:32px;position:relative}.timeline-item[data-v-51160948]:before{content:"";position:absolute;left:7px;top:20px;bottom:-32px;width:1px;background:var(--border)}.timeline-item[data-v-51160948]:last-child:before{display:none}.timeline-dot[data-v-51160948]{width:14px;height:14px;border-radius:50%;border:2px solid var(--accent);background:var(--bg-base);margin-top:3px;flex-shrink:0;position:relative;z-index:1}.timeline-body[data-v-51160948]{padding-bottom:8px}.timeline-title[data-v-51160948]{font-size:1rem;font-weight:600;color:var(--text);margin-bottom:4px;letter-spacing:-.01em}.timeline-org[data-v-51160948]{margin-bottom:4px}.timeline-org a[data-v-51160948]{color:var(--accent);font-size:.875rem}.timeline-date[data-v-51160948]{font-size:.8rem;color:var(--text-muted);margin-bottom:12px;font-style:italic}.timeline-desc[data-v-51160948]{font-size:.9rem;color:var(--text-muted);margin:0 0 12px;line-height:1.65}.timeline-list[data-v-51160948]{margin:0 0 12px;padding-left:20px}.timeline-list li[data-v-51160948]{font-size:.875rem;color:var(--text-muted);margin:6px 0;line-height:1.6}.timeline-stack[data-v-51160948]{display:flex;flex-wrap:wrap;gap:6px;margin-top:12px}.skill-section[data-v-51160948]{margin-bottom:36px}.skill-group[data-v-51160948]{display:flex;flex-wrap:wrap;gap:0}.interests[data-v-51160948]{display:flex;flex-direction:column;gap:12px}.interest-item[data-v-51160948]{display:flex;align-items:center;gap:12px;font-size:.875rem;color:var(--text-muted)}.interest-icon[data-v-51160948]{font-size:1.1rem}@media (min-width:960px){.resume-layout[data-v-51160948]{grid-template-columns:1fr 300px;align-items:start}}